Files
frameworks_base/libs/androidfw
Adam Lesinski 4ca56978a9 AAPT2: Add workaround for non-standard package IDs
The dynamic ref table used to map build-time IDs to runtime IDs
is mainly used for shared resource libraries and has a few built-in
mappings (app 0x7f and framework 0x01).

Using a non-standard package ID like 0x80 causes a failure in package ID
lookup. The solution is to ship the dynamic_ref_table with an identity mapping
with any resource table that uses a non-standard package ID.

Adds some tests to ensure this works correctly.

Bug: 37498913
Test: make libandroidfw_tests
Test: make aapt2_tests
Change-Id: Ic3f67942384d34e7fdcbc94ded360e940e3ebc8a
2017-04-26 21:55:31 -07:00
..
2017-02-08 06:04:52 -08:00
2016-12-02 11:23:12 -08:00
2017-02-15 10:50:23 -08:00
2017-02-15 10:50:23 -08:00
2017-02-15 10:50:23 -08:00
2017-02-16 09:50:00 -08:00
2017-02-15 10:50:23 -08:00